Early Childhood Block Grant

Purpose
The Early Childhood Block Grant is administered through the Arizona Department of Education, and promotes student achievement by providing additional funding for early childhood programs. Funding is directly available to public school districts and charter schools who serve children in kindergarten programs, and grades one, two and three.

Method of Funding
Early Childhood Block Grant (ECBG) funds are allocated to all Local Education Agencies (LEAs) that serve children in Kindergarten through third grade. The allocation amount is based on the number of pupils in kindergarten programs and grades one, two, and three who were eligible for free lunches during the prior fiscal year under the National School Lunch and Child Nutrition Acts (42 United States Code Sections 1751 through 1785).

Program Requirements
LEAs who use ECBG funds for kindergarten through third grade programs should have written goals and objectives regarding student outcomes and a developmentally appropriate method for collecting information concerning program effectiveness. The goals and objectives should target student outcomes that would not be possible without utilizing ECBG funds. Requirements are listed in further detail in the Early Childhood Block Grant Policy Manual.

ECBG Application
Application for the Early Childhood Block Grant must be made online through the Arizona Department of Education Grants Management System.
